Given:
Height of man = 6 ft
Height of man's shadow = 11 feet
Height of building's shadow = 139 feet
To find:
The height of the building.
Solution:
We know that the heights of the objects and there shadows are always proportional.
Let x be the height of the building.
Multiply both sides by 139.
Therefore, the building is 75.8 feet long.

Of that list, only the square and the rectangle have the property you are asking for.
Try drawing it. The parallelogram has a shorter diagonal from the two obtuse angles than the diagonal from the two acute angles.
The rhombus has the same property as the parallelogram.
The kite has a far longer diagonal from the angle enclosed by the two long sides going to the angle enclosed by the two shorter sides, than a line going from the angle enclosed by one shorter and one longer side to the other angle made the same way.
